The renovation of a 1940’s home on the north side of Seattle is a meditation in clean aesthetics. With design by White Space Design Group, removal of a portion of the wall separating kitchen and dining room opened the space and maximized storage. A monochromatic color palette is anything but boring with dark tile flooring in the kitchen and warm wood in the dining room. Light grey walls and ceiling are a subtle contrast to the bright white cabinetry and PentalQuartz countertops in Cascade White. A geometric shaped tile backsplash in brig ht white adds interest and modernity. Black cabinet and drawer pulls match the black faucet while complementing the floor and stainless steel appliances.
